Popis: We report on our recent development of quasi-continuous-wave 940-nm laser diode (LD) bars with passive cooled type. The 10 LD bar stacks with a narrow pitch of 1.54 mm have demonstrated a high output power of 10.1 kW, corresponding to 1 kW/bar, under 200- $\mu \text{s}$ pulses at 50-Hz operating frequency. The maximum conversion efficiency of 58% has been achieved at an output power of 300 W. In condition of 1000 $\mu \text{s}$ pulses at 10-Hz operating frequency, we have achieved an output power of 0.93 kW and a conversion efficiency of 59%, respectively. We consider that the LD bar stacks are suitable for diode pumped high-energy class solid-state lasers.
